Ai Massey serves as a key procurement professional at the Naval Surface Warfare Center, Dahlgren Division (NSWC Dahlgren), supporting the Department of the Navy’s mission to advance integrated warfighting systems through research, development, test, and evaluation. Specializing in technical acquisitions, Massey manages contracts for advanced sensors, command and control platforms, electronic warfare systems, and embedded computing technologies. Their work directly enables the modernization of naval surface combat systems, ensuring interoperability across networked battle environments. Massey routinely handles complex, high-technical-risk procurements requiring deep domain expertise in defense electronics and mission-critical software integration. Massey maintains consistent partnerships with a select group of contractors including TEX-TECH ENGINEERED COMPOSITES, LLC for advanced material systems, TATITLEK GOVERNMENT SERVICES, INC. for technical support and engineering services, 3DB LABS INC for additive manufacturing solutions, WASTE REMOVAL USA, LLC for environmental compliance services, and BOWHEAD PROGRAM MANAGEMENT & OPERATIONS, LLC for program management and logistics integration. These relationships reflect a preference for established vendors with proven capability in defense-grade engineering and mission-specific execution, often involving long-term, performance-based contract structures. Massey’s procurement portfolio exhibits a 100% preference for full and open competition, with no set-asides designated for 8(a), HUBZone, SDVOSB, or other socioeconomic programs. This reflects a mission-critical focus on technical capability over socioeconomic criteria, prioritizing performance, security, and system readiness in high-consequence defense environments. The primary NAICS categories under Massey’s oversight include 541715 for research and development in physical and engineering sciences, 541330 for specialized engineering services, 334111 for electronic computer manufacturing, and 336415 for guided missile propulsion systems. These reflect a technical focus on sensor development, signal processing, embedded systems, and propulsion technologies critical to naval surface warfare modernization.
